On October 16 and 17th, 2019, a delegation of the Ministry of Labor of Colombia, formed by experts of the Policies Management of Labor Migration and the Public Employment Service, visited Ecuador to provide technical assistance on labor migration with an emphasis on attention to returned nationals. 

 

During two days, the experts presented the Colombian policies for returned nationals to the officers from the Ministries of Labor and External Relations of Ecuador, especially those initiatives focused on inter-institutional coordination, the promotion of hiring returned migrants by national companies, professional training initiatives, and actions by the Public Employment Service through the information card for returned citizens. 

 

In its Final Report, the Ministry of Labor of Ecuador highlighted the importance of having learned the procedure to develop an Information and Labor Orientation primer and the Employment Road Map for returned nationals. 

 

Similarly, among their Next Steps and after consultation by the Technical Secretariat, the Government of Ecuador noted that elements addressed during the exchange will be used by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and Human Mobility to update the Catalogue of Services for Returned Migrants, a document that is used to disseminate regulations, services, and products to serve this population. They added that the Employment Road Map will be revised to apply, when possible, to the Ecuadorian case.
